Inspiration

Last night I got inspired by Mixed Media Artist Teesha Moore http://www.teeshaslandofodd.com/1/temp.html. She definitely has her own style. One of the things I love about her is that she often just writes what's on her mind without censoring. It's kind of like a stream of consciousness. She has lots of journal pages that she's made on her website and you can read them easily. One of them was just talking about the pen she was using to write on that particular page. She left me asking,"Well, what kind of pen is it?" Now I want one. You get the idea. She makes me feel like I should stop worrying so much about WHAT I'm writting and just write something. It doesn't matter. If I really think about it, art journaling is suppossed to show an insight to who you are, let the audience get to know you, the boring, the ugly, and the beautiful. Crafty Clothespins

These are so much fun to make! I painted the clothespins first, then decoupaged using images from ARTchix studios. Then I added the beaded embelishment. Use them for whatever, they don't have a specific purpose. Just kind of fun to look at.
